2030年全球介入性神经设备市场将达49亿美元

2023年全球介入神经设备市场估计为36亿美元,预计2030年将达到49亿美元,2023-2030年分析期间复合年增长率为4.6%。脑栓塞和动脉瘤弹簧圈栓塞装置是本报告分析的细分市场之一,预计复合年增长率为 4.8%,到分析期结束时将达到 20 亿美元。在分析期间,脑血管成形术和支架系统领域的复合年增长率预计为 3.1%。

美国市场预估价值9.743亿美元,中国预期复合年增长率为4.3%

预计 2023 年美国介入性神经设备市场规模将达 9.743 亿美元。中国作为全球第二大经济体,预计2030年市场规模将达到7.736亿美元,2023年至2030年复合年增长率为4.3%。其他值得注意的区域市场包括日本和加拿大,在分析期间预计复合年增长率分别为 4.5% 和 3.7%。在欧洲,德国的复合年增长率预计为 3.8%。

什么是介入神经设备?

介入性神经设备是用于微创治疗中风、动脉瘤和动静脉畸形 (AVM) 等神经血管疾病的专用医疗设备。这些设备包括导管、支架、栓塞弹簧圈和血栓移除系统,旨在引导大脑复杂而脆弱的脉管系统。介入性神经病学是现代医学中至关重要的领域,因为它为患者提供了一种比传统开放性手术侵入性更小的替代方案,从而缩短了康復时间,降低了併发症的风险,并改善了治疗结果。随着神经血管疾病的盛行率在全球范围内持续上升,对先进介入神经设备的需求不断增加,使其成为治疗和管理这些危及生命的疾病的重要工具。

科技进步如何形塑介入神经设备市场?

技术进步正在显着塑造介入神经设备市场,特别是透过影像处理、导管设计和材料科学方面的创新。高解析度 3D血管造影术和即时术中成像等诊断成像技术的进步透过提供脑血管系统的详细可视化来提高神经血管手术的准确性和安全性。更灵活、可操纵的导管的开发提高了介入医生在复杂动脉途径中导航的能力,降低了血管损伤的风险并提高了手术成功率。材料科学的创新,包括使用生物相容性和渗透性材料,使支架和栓塞弹簧圈等设备更安全、更有效,从而更有效地治疗复杂的神经血管疾病。这些技术趋势正在推动介入性神经装置在医疗保健环境中的采用,从而为神经血管疾病患者提供更有效、更侵入性的治疗选择。

为什么医疗保健领域对介入神经科设备的需求不断增加?

由于神经血管疾病的盛行率不断增加、人口老化以及微创手术采用率的不断提高,医疗保健领域对介入性神经设备的需求不断增加。中风仍然是全球死亡和残疾的主要原因,因此需要有效的治疗方案,例如血栓切除装置和栓塞弹簧圈。人口老化也增加了对介入神经设备的需求,因为老年人患动脉瘤和动静脉畸形等需要先进介入治疗的疾病的风险更高。患者和医疗保健提供者寻求开放性手术的替代方案,以实现更快的恢復时间、更短的住院时间和更低的併发症发生率。此外,介入神经科医生的专业培训和中风中心的扩张提高了医疗机构执行复杂神经血管手术的能力,并增加了这些设备的采用。随着神经血管疾病负担持续增加,介入神经器械的需求预计将增加。

Global Interventional Neurology Devices Market to Reach US$4.9 Billion by 2030

The global market for Interventional Neurology Devices estimated at US$3.6 Billion in the year 2023, is expected to reach US$4.9 Bill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 4.6% over the analysis period 2023-2030. Cerebral Embolization & Aneurysm Coiling Device, one of the segments analyzed in the report, is expected to record a 4.8% CAGR and reach US$2.0 Billion by the end of the analysis period. Growth in the Cerebral Angioplasty & Stenting Systems segment is estimated at 3.1% CAGR over the analysis period.

The U.S. Market is Estimated at US$974.3 Million While China is Forecast to Grow at 4.3% CAGR

The Interventional Neurology Devices market in the U.S. is estimated at US$974.3 Million in the year 2023. China, the world's second largest economy, is forecast to reach a projected market size of US$773.6 Million by the year 2030 trailing a CAGR of 4.3% over the analysis period 2023-2030. Among the other noteworthy geographic markets are Japan and Canada, each forecast to grow at a CAGR of 4.5% and 3.7% respectively over the analysis period. Within Europe, Germany is forecast to grow at approximately 3.8% CAGR.

What Are Interventional Neurology Devices and Why Are They Crucial in Treating Neurovascular Disorders?

Interventional neurology devices are specialized medical instruments used in the minimally invasive treatment of neurovascular disorders, such as strokes, aneurysms, and arteriovenous malformations (AVMs). These devices include catheters, stents, embolization coils, and clot retrieval systems, which are designed to navigate the intricate and delicate vasculature of the brain. Interventional neurology has become a crucial field in modern medicine, as it offers patients less invasive alternatives to traditional open surgeries, leading to faster recovery times, reduced risk of complications, and improved outcomes. As the prevalence of neurovascular disorders continues to rise globally, the demand for advanced interventional neurology devices is increasing, making them essential tools in the treatment and management of these life-threatening conditions.

How Are Technological Advancements Shaping the Interventional Neurology Devices Market?

Technological advancements are significantly shaping the interventional neurology devices market, particularly through innovations in imaging, catheter design, and materials science. Advances in imaging technologies, such as high-resolution 3D angiography and real-time intraoperative imaging, are enhancing the precision and safety of neurovascular procedures by providing detailed visualization of the brain’s vasculature. The development of more flexible and steerable catheters is improving the ability of interventionalists to navigate complex arterial pathways, reducing the risk of vessel injury and improving procedural success rates. Innovations in materials science, including the use of biocompatible and radiopaque materials, are enhancing the safety and efficacy of devices such as stents and embolization coils, making them more effective in treating complex neurovascular conditions. These technological trends are driving the adoption of interventional neurology devices across healthcare settings, as they enable more effective and less invasive treatment options for patients with neurovascular disorders.

Why Is There an Increasing Demand for Interventional Neurology Devices in Healthcare?

The demand for interventional neurology devices is increasing in healthcare due to the growing prevalence of neurovascular disorders, the aging population, and the rising adoption of minimally invasive procedures. Stroke remains a leading cause of death and disability worldwide, driving the need for effective treatment options such as thrombectomy devices and embolization coils. The aging population is also contributing to the demand for interventional neurology devices, as older adults are at higher risk for conditions such as aneurysms and AVMs that require advanced interventional treatment. The trend towards minimally invasive procedures is further fueling demand, as patients and healthcare providers seek alternatives to open surgeries that offer faster recovery times, reduced hospital stays, and lower complication rates. Additionally, the increasing availability of specialized training for interventional neurologists and the expansion of stroke centers are enhancing the adoption of these devices, as more healthcare facilities are equipped to perform complex neurovascular procedures. As the burden of neurovascular diseases continues to grow, the demand for interventional neurology devices is expected to increase.
